Gattaca is a 1997 science fiction film produced in the US that depicts a future society that uses reproductive technology and genetic engineering in order to produce genetically enhanced human beings. By selectively choosing certain genes, scientists and physicians ensure that individuals born using reproductive technologies have desirable …Genetic engineering is changing the genetic material of an organism by removing or altering genes within that organism, or by inserting genes from another organism. …

The Gizmo shows petri dishes that contain different strains of bacteria (white dots) and caterpillars (Lepidoptera sp. larvae).Genetic engineering, also called gene editing or genetic modification, is the process of altering an organism's DNA in order to change a trait. This can mean changing a single base pair, adding or deleting a single gene, or changing an even larger strand of DNA. Genetic engineering has come a long way since its inception, with continuous advancements shaping the field and its potential applications. Key milestones, such as the discovery of restriction enzymes, gene targeting techniques, and the development of the CRISPR-Cas9 system, have driven progress in manipulating DNA for various purposes.Students will explore these question and more in this lesson plan.
